Good joint levels: Aleve (Naproxen) is a good one. The drug distribution is noted to be substantial in synovial joints. It is a good anti-inflammatory with good analgesic effects.

Motrin or Aleve (naproxen): It is recommended to not use ASPIRIN, because it can raise the levels of uric acid in the blood. Ask your health care provider if a NSAID would be appropriate treatment for your condition.
